Utilizing Online Tools for Efficient Filing

Filing for bankruptcy in NYC doesn’t have to be a maze of confusion and paperwork, thanks to the online tools provided by the NYC bankruptcy court. Navigating the filing process becomes less daunting with these digital aids, whether you’re flying solo or have an attorney by your side.

The eSR electronic self-representation is one such tool that’s worth its weight in gold. It simplifies filing for Chapters 7 and 13 bankruptcies by guiding users through each step of their case management. This platform not only makes things less intimidating but also saves heaps of time.

Besides eSR, there’s also a pro se document upload feature which allows individuals without legal representation to easily submit their documents online. The court has made sure that access to hearing calendars and filing procedures is just a click away at both Southern District Court and Eastern District Court, empowering people with the resources they need. Common Pitfalls in Self-Representation

Diving headfirst into NYC’s bankruptcy court without a lawyer might seem like saving a buck, but it’s more like stepping onto a minefield blindfolded. The law is complex and unforgiving. For starters, navigating the procedural maze alone can lead to critical errors—missing deadlines, improperly filed documents, or incorrect claim amounts—which can derail your case faster than you can say “bankruptcy.” These mistakes aren’t just common; they’re expected when you go at it solo.

Beyond paperwork snafus, there’s the risk of misinterpreting legal requirements or overlooking potential defenses that could save your financial skin. With resources like judicial seminars disclosure and financial literacy information, even well-intentioned DIYers often find themselves outmatched by the subtleties of bankruptcy code and judicial conduct expectations.
